No Snow?
It's hard to believe it's November and there is so little snow at 2000m in the Alpstein. A few of us took advantage of these last days of autumn and went on a hike today from Wasserauen to the Marwees range and back. The temperatures were mild and required only a fleece top and the occasional wind breaker. The winds were extremely strong at the summit, which made the single track trails a little nerve racking. I'm sure these days are numbered and it won't be long before we're back with snowshoes. Photos of the hike, taken with the new Nikon D80, are online.
